SQL vs Python for Data Science: Which Is the Better Starting Point?
There is no one-size-fits-all answer to SQL vs Python. Your starting point depends on your goals, background, and the type of data work you want to do. However, SQL is usually the easier first step for beginners because it teaches you how to find, filter, sort, and manage data stored in databases. Python is typically the next step for more advanced data analysis, automation, visualization, and machine learning.
| Area | SQL | Python |
| Main Use | Querying databases | Analysis and programming |
| Learning Curve | Easier to start | Broader and more technical |
| Machine Learning | Limited | Widely used |
| Data Visualization | Basic | Advanced options |
What Is SQL and What Is Python?
SQL is used to retrieve and organize structured data. Python is a programming language used to clean and analyze data, identify patterns, create visualizations, and build machine learning models.

When Should You Learn SQL First?
Start with SQL if you are new to coding, interested in analytics, or expect to work with databases and business reports. Its focused syntax makes it easier to see results quickly.
When Should You Learn Python First?
Choose Python first if you already understand coding or want to focus on AI, automation, or machine learning.
Why SQL and Python Work Best Together?
SQL helps you get the right data, while Python helps you analyze it. Learning both gives you a more complete and practical data science skill set.

A Step-by-Step Learning Roadmap for Beginners
You do not need to master SQL and Python at the same time. Start with one, get comfortable, and then build on it.
- Step 1: Begin with Everyday SQL Commands: Learn how to use SELECT, WHERE, ORDER BY, GROUP BY, and JOIN. Try writing queries around simple questions, such as finding the best-selling product or monthly sales.
- Step 2: Get Familiar with How Databases Work: Understand tables, rows, columns, and relationships. Once these basics are clear, SQL queries become easier to follow.
- Step 3: Move on to Python Basics: Learn variables, lists, conditions, loops, and functions. There is no need to rush into advanced libraries.
- Step 4: Start Working with Real Data: Use pandas to clean and explore a small dataset. Create a few simple charts to see how the numbers tell a story.
- Step 5: Bring Both Skills Together: Use SQL to retrieve data and Python to analyze it. . Even one small project can help you understand how the tools work in practice.
Common Mistakes to Avoid When Learning SQL and Python
Most beginners struggle not because the tools are difficult, but because they try to learn too much too quickly.
- Jumping Between Too Many Topics: Stay with the basics until they feel familiar before moving to advanced concepts.
- Learning Commands Without Using Them: Instead of memorizing syntax, solve small data problems and learn from the mistakes you make.
- Watching Tutorials without Practicing: Pause the lesson, write the code yourself, and experiment with different results.
- Keeping SQL and Python Separate: Try a simple project where SQL retrieves data and Python helps you explore it.
- Overlooking theStory Behind the Data: Technical skills matter, but you should also be able to explain what the results mean and why they matter.

SQL can open doors to data analyst and database-related roles, but it is usually not enough for a data scientist position. Most data science jobs also require knowledge of Python or R, statistics, data visualization, and machine learning.
Yes. Data scientists often use SQL and Python in the same workflow:
SQL retrieves and organizes data.
Python cleans and analyzes data.
Python creates visualizations and machine learning models.
Together, they support efficient end-to-end data projects.
Python is generally more important for machine learning. It supports tools for data preparation, model building, and evaluation. SQL still matters because machine learning projects often begin with data stored in databases.
